FROM PAPER TO POWERFUL

From any paper or digital source, teachers deliver their materials as interactive online activities, their way. With full control over interactivity, grading and reporting, teachers create and align activities to their pedagogy, quickly.

Any familiar application can be used to create and extend learning materials - Microsoft Word, Powerpoint or OneNote, Google Apps, or trusted materials in PDF format. Teachers don't re-key or re-create content with Literatu. 

Literatu lets teachers quickly extend their capabilities and materials, making it easy to create, assemble and support differentiated learning programs. Everyone agrees 'one size does not fit all'.

BUILD LEARNING PATHWAYS

Learning Pathways let teachers plan and implement remediation and extension activities that auto-assign to students depending on their achievement against plan.

Literatu automatically routes students to the next most appropriate activity, giving teachers visibility over who is doing what and where each learning pathway is taking students.

Teachers use pathways to keep students progressing, knowing at all times who is up to what.

MICROSOFT O365, GOOGLE AND EDMODO INTEGRATED

Teachers tell us they simply don't need or want systems that create MORE logins, more passwords and more maintenance.

That's why Literatu is integrated with Microsoft O365, as a Google App for Education, and as an Edmodo application. Edmodo integration is complete including gradebooks, badges and calendars.

Of course we also integrate with calendars, email and cloud drives where teachers can instantly link activities in Literatu.

 

 

ALIGNED TO CURRICULUMS

Literatu supports curriculum alignment and reporting for all activities, with the US Common Core, Australian and Singapore curriculums pre-loaded.

Teachers can extend their selected curriculum to their specifications, at any level.
